Snow day

July 26th, 2011 — 9:38am



As if we don’t have enough troubles, yesterday we were hit by the worst snows in 15 years.

It’s easy to get sniffy about 6 inches of snow and temps in the mid 20s, but in a city of broken homes, collapsed chimneys, and chemical toilets it just makes everything that much worse.


It was wonderful snowball and snowman snow, though. Today it’s just icy.
